Microsoft has 521 active AI-related job listings. The majority of these roles are focused on agents, representing 37% of the total, followed by application and serving infrastructure. Engineering is the most frequent function, with a significant number of openings, and the United States is the primary hiring country. Frequent tech tags include agent orchestration, model serving, and LLM observability, suggesting a focus on operationalizing AI models. Over the last 30 days, Microsoft has added 280 new AI roles, a 157% increase compared to the previous 30-day period.

Frequently asked questions

  • What AI roles is Microsoft hiring for?

    Microsoft currently has 343 active AI-related roles in our index. The most common open titles are: Principal Software Engineer (19), Senior Software Engineer (19), Software Engineer II (8), Principal Applied Scientist (7), Principal Data Scientist (4). Most positions are in Engineering and Research.

  • What stage of AI development does Microsoft focus on?

    Microsoft's active AI hiring is concentrated in: agents (36%), application (21%), serving infrastructure (19%). These categories follow a seven-stage AI lifecycle: data, pre-training, post-training, serving infrastructure, agents, evaluation, and application.

  • Where is Microsoft hiring AI talent?

    Microsoft is hiring AI talent in: United States (308 roles), Canada (15 roles), Japan (8 roles), United Kingdom (7 roles).

  • What skills does Microsoft look for in AI roles?

    Job postings at Microsoft most frequently mention: Computer Architecture, Python, Machine Learning, C#, C++.

  • How many AI roles has Microsoft posted recently?

    In the past 30 days, Microsoft has posted 227 new AI-related roles.
